[quote name='smcd' date='Oct 26 2005, 06:21 AM']The Lexus GS has knee airbags to protect the driver and passengers legs in a crash.? Does the e60 have something similar?
[snapback]188727[/snapback]
Yes, the US laws require it.

that's why there is no storage compartment under the light switch on the US spec E60. There is additional padding to protect the knees in case of an accident.
